Loading Cargo.lock +988 −833 File changed.Preview size limit exceeded, changes collapsed. Show changes Cargo.toml +1 −1 Original line number Diff line number Diff line Loading @@ -3,7 +3,7 @@ members = ["pipe-cli", "pipe-lib"] resolver = "2" [workspace.package] version = "0.0.8" version = "0.0.9" authors = ["Jason Wohlgemuth <wohlgemuthjh@ornl.gov>"] description = "Parallel Integration and Processing Engine" documentation = "https://pipe.ornl.gov" Loading lcov.info +15 −15 Original line number Diff line number Diff line TN: SF:/root/dev/command/pipe-cli/src/commands/check/checks/is_valid_python_module/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/check/checks/is_valid_python_module/mod.rs FN:16,run FNF:1 FNDA:0,run Loading @@ -9,7 +9,7 @@ LF:2 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/check/checks/template/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/check/checks/template/mod.rs FN:6,_run FNF:1 FNDA:0,_run Loading @@ -19,7 +19,7 @@ LF:2 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/check/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/check/mod.rs FN:22,run FNF:1 FNDA:0,run Loading Loading @@ -98,7 +98,7 @@ LF:71 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/doctor/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/doctor/mod.rs FN:6,run FNF:1 FNDA:0,run Loading @@ -107,7 +107,7 @@ LF:1 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/run/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/run/mod.rs FN:16,run FNF:1 FNDA:0,run Loading Loading @@ -156,7 +156,7 @@ LF:41 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/main.rs SF:/root/dev/pipe/pipe-cli/src/main.rs FN:26,main FNF:1 FNDA:0,main Loading @@ -183,7 +183,7 @@ LF:19 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/reporters/console/mod.rs SF:/root/dev/pipe/pipe-cli/src/reporters/console/mod.rs FN:5,run FN:43,print_pass FN:52,print_fail Loading Loading @@ -225,7 +225,7 @@ LF:30 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/reporters/json/mod.rs SF:/root/dev/pipe/pipe-cli/src/reporters/json/mod.rs FN:10,run FNF:1 FNDA:0,run Loading Loading @@ -263,7 +263,7 @@ LF:30 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/reporters/stdout/mod.rs SF:/root/dev/pipe/pipe-cli/src/reporters/stdout/mod.rs FN:5,run FNF:1 FNDA:0,run Loading @@ -273,7 +273,7 @@ LF:2 LH:0 end_of_record TN: SF:/root/dev/command/pipe-lib/src/config.rs SF:/root/dev/pipe/pipe-lib/src/config.rs FN:119,Config::get_environment_variables FN:139,Config::get_inputs FN:169,Config::get_module_list Loading Loading @@ -567,7 +567,7 @@ LF:262 LH:42 end_of_record TN: SF:/root/dev/command/pipe-lib/src/lib.rs SF:/root/dev/pipe/pipe-lib/src/lib.rs FN:81,<impl PartialEq for Details>::eq FN:88,<impl Deref for PyProjectToml>::deref FN:93,PyProjectToml::read Loading Loading @@ -608,7 +608,7 @@ LF:25 LH:20 end_of_record TN: SF:/root/dev/command/pipe-lib/src/script.rs SF:/root/dev/pipe/pipe-lib/src/script.rs FN:300,Command::test FN:324,EnvironmentValue::formatted_prefix FN:329,EnvironmentValue::from_value Loading Loading @@ -866,8 +866,8 @@ DA:665,1 DA:666,0 DA:668,0 DA:669,0 DA:672,4 DA:673,2 DA:672,2 DA:673,1 DA:675,1 DA:677,1 DA:678,1 Loading Loading @@ -1031,7 +1031,7 @@ LF:335 LH:182 end_of_record TN: SF:/root/dev/command/pipe-lib/src/util.rs SF:/root/dev/pipe/pipe-lib/src/util.rs FN:25,Label::dry_run FN:29,Label::invalid FN:32,Label::fmt_invalid Loading pipe-lib/src/config.rs +4 −4 Original line number Diff line number Diff line use bon::builder; use bon::Builder; use owo_colors::OwoColorize; use rayon::prelude::*; use serde::{Deserialize, Serialize}; Loading Loading @@ -34,7 +34,7 @@ pub struct Check { /// Parent directory of the item being checked when not used within a workflow pub parent: Option<String>, } #[derive(Clone, Debug, Deserialize, Serialize)] #[derive(Clone, Builder, Debug, Deserialize, Serialize)] #[builder(start_fn(name = init))] pub struct Config { /// Unique workflow identifier Loading Loading @@ -73,7 +73,7 @@ pub struct Config { pub output: Option<String>, pub options: Option<ConfigOptions>, } #[derive(Clone, Debug, Deserialize, Serialize)] #[derive(Builder, Clone, Debug, Deserialize, Serialize)] #[builder(start_fn(name = init))] pub struct ConfigOptions { #[builder] Loading Loading @@ -103,7 +103,7 @@ pub struct Parameters { /// Custom string data pub custom: Option<String>, } #[derive(Clone, Debug, Deserialize, Serialize)] #[derive(Builder, Clone, Debug, Deserialize, Serialize)] #[builder(start_fn(name = init))] pub struct Rule { /// Name of the rule (displayed by the progress bar) Loading pipe-lib/src/lib.rs +2 −2 Original line number Diff line number Diff line #![allow(dead_code)] #![allow(clippy::large_enum_variant)] #![allow(clippy::wrong_self_convention)] use bon::builder; use bon::Builder; use clap::ValueEnum; use color_eyre::eyre::{Report, Result}; use derive_more::Display; Loading Loading @@ -63,7 +63,7 @@ pub struct Reporter { /// Semantic version /// /// see <https://semver.org/> #[derive(Clone, Debug, Deserialize, Display, Serialize)] #[derive(Builder, Clone, Debug, Deserialize, Display, Serialize)] #[display("{}.{}.{}", major, minor, patch)] #[builder(start_fn(name = init))] pub struct SemanticVersion { Loading Loading
Cargo.toml +1 −1 Original line number Diff line number Diff line Loading @@ -3,7 +3,7 @@ members = ["pipe-cli", "pipe-lib"] resolver = "2" [workspace.package] version = "0.0.8" version = "0.0.9" authors = ["Jason Wohlgemuth <wohlgemuthjh@ornl.gov>"] description = "Parallel Integration and Processing Engine" documentation = "https://pipe.ornl.gov" Loading
lcov.info +15 −15 Original line number Diff line number Diff line TN: SF:/root/dev/command/pipe-cli/src/commands/check/checks/is_valid_python_module/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/check/checks/is_valid_python_module/mod.rs FN:16,run FNF:1 FNDA:0,run Loading @@ -9,7 +9,7 @@ LF:2 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/check/checks/template/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/check/checks/template/mod.rs FN:6,_run FNF:1 FNDA:0,_run Loading @@ -19,7 +19,7 @@ LF:2 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/check/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/check/mod.rs FN:22,run FNF:1 FNDA:0,run Loading Loading @@ -98,7 +98,7 @@ LF:71 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/doctor/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/doctor/mod.rs FN:6,run FNF:1 FNDA:0,run Loading @@ -107,7 +107,7 @@ LF:1 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/commands/run/mod.rs SF:/root/dev/pipe/pipe-cli/src/commands/run/mod.rs FN:16,run FNF:1 FNDA:0,run Loading Loading @@ -156,7 +156,7 @@ LF:41 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/main.rs SF:/root/dev/pipe/pipe-cli/src/main.rs FN:26,main FNF:1 FNDA:0,main Loading @@ -183,7 +183,7 @@ LF:19 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/reporters/console/mod.rs SF:/root/dev/pipe/pipe-cli/src/reporters/console/mod.rs FN:5,run FN:43,print_pass FN:52,print_fail Loading Loading @@ -225,7 +225,7 @@ LF:30 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/reporters/json/mod.rs SF:/root/dev/pipe/pipe-cli/src/reporters/json/mod.rs FN:10,run FNF:1 FNDA:0,run Loading Loading @@ -263,7 +263,7 @@ LF:30 LH:0 end_of_record TN: SF:/root/dev/command/pipe-cli/src/reporters/stdout/mod.rs SF:/root/dev/pipe/pipe-cli/src/reporters/stdout/mod.rs FN:5,run FNF:1 FNDA:0,run Loading @@ -273,7 +273,7 @@ LF:2 LH:0 end_of_record TN: SF:/root/dev/command/pipe-lib/src/config.rs SF:/root/dev/pipe/pipe-lib/src/config.rs FN:119,Config::get_environment_variables FN:139,Config::get_inputs FN:169,Config::get_module_list Loading Loading @@ -567,7 +567,7 @@ LF:262 LH:42 end_of_record TN: SF:/root/dev/command/pipe-lib/src/lib.rs SF:/root/dev/pipe/pipe-lib/src/lib.rs FN:81,<impl PartialEq for Details>::eq FN:88,<impl Deref for PyProjectToml>::deref FN:93,PyProjectToml::read Loading Loading @@ -608,7 +608,7 @@ LF:25 LH:20 end_of_record TN: SF:/root/dev/command/pipe-lib/src/script.rs SF:/root/dev/pipe/pipe-lib/src/script.rs FN:300,Command::test FN:324,EnvironmentValue::formatted_prefix FN:329,EnvironmentValue::from_value Loading Loading @@ -866,8 +866,8 @@ DA:665,1 DA:666,0 DA:668,0 DA:669,0 DA:672,4 DA:673,2 DA:672,2 DA:673,1 DA:675,1 DA:677,1 DA:678,1 Loading Loading @@ -1031,7 +1031,7 @@ LF:335 LH:182 end_of_record TN: SF:/root/dev/command/pipe-lib/src/util.rs SF:/root/dev/pipe/pipe-lib/src/util.rs FN:25,Label::dry_run FN:29,Label::invalid FN:32,Label::fmt_invalid Loading
pipe-lib/src/config.rs +4 −4 Original line number Diff line number Diff line use bon::builder; use bon::Builder; use owo_colors::OwoColorize; use rayon::prelude::*; use serde::{Deserialize, Serialize}; Loading Loading @@ -34,7 +34,7 @@ pub struct Check { /// Parent directory of the item being checked when not used within a workflow pub parent: Option<String>, } #[derive(Clone, Debug, Deserialize, Serialize)] #[derive(Clone, Builder, Debug, Deserialize, Serialize)] #[builder(start_fn(name = init))] pub struct Config { /// Unique workflow identifier Loading Loading @@ -73,7 +73,7 @@ pub struct Config { pub output: Option<String>, pub options: Option<ConfigOptions>, } #[derive(Clone, Debug, Deserialize, Serialize)] #[derive(Builder, Clone, Debug, Deserialize, Serialize)] #[builder(start_fn(name = init))] pub struct ConfigOptions { #[builder] Loading Loading @@ -103,7 +103,7 @@ pub struct Parameters { /// Custom string data pub custom: Option<String>, } #[derive(Clone, Debug, Deserialize, Serialize)] #[derive(Builder, Clone, Debug, Deserialize, Serialize)] #[builder(start_fn(name = init))] pub struct Rule { /// Name of the rule (displayed by the progress bar) Loading
pipe-lib/src/lib.rs +2 −2 Original line number Diff line number Diff line #![allow(dead_code)] #![allow(clippy::large_enum_variant)] #![allow(clippy::wrong_self_convention)] use bon::builder; use bon::Builder; use clap::ValueEnum; use color_eyre::eyre::{Report, Result}; use derive_more::Display; Loading Loading @@ -63,7 +63,7 @@ pub struct Reporter { /// Semantic version /// /// see <https://semver.org/> #[derive(Clone, Debug, Deserialize, Display, Serialize)] #[derive(Builder, Clone, Debug, Deserialize, Display, Serialize)] #[display("{}.{}.{}", major, minor, patch)] #[builder(start_fn(name = init))] pub struct SemanticVersion { Loading